Marshall Wace LLP Has $1.09 Million Stake in Urban Outfitters, Inc. (NASDAQ:URBN)

Urban Outfitters logo with Retail/Wholesale background

Marshall Wace LLP lessened its stake in Urban Outfitters, Inc. (NASDAQ:URBN - Free Report) by 98.1%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 19,868 shares of the apparel retailer's stock after selling 999,394 shares during the period. Marshall Wace LLP's holdings in Urban Outfitters were worth $1,090,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Urban Outfitters Profile

(Free Report)

Urban Outfitters, Inc engages in the retail and wholesale of general consumer products. The company operates through three segments: Retail, Wholesale, and Nuuly. It operates Urban Outfitters stores, which offer women's and men's fashion apparel, activewear, intimates, footwear, accessories, home goods, electronics, and beauty products for young adults aged 18 to 28; and Anthropologie stores that provide women's apparel, accessories, intimates, shoes, and home furnishings, as well as gifts, decorative items, and beauty and wellness products for women aged 28 to 45.
